According to a new report published by Allied Market Research, titled, “IoT in Construction Market," The IoT in Construction Market size was valued at $11.2 billion in 2021, and is estimated to reach $44.2 billion by 2031, growing at a CAGR of 14.6% from 2022 to 2031.

The main purpose of IoT in construction industry is to use electronically connected hardware and software to ensure the most efficient use of resources, a well-thought-out technical approach, and controlled construction costs. The Internet of Things (IoT) provides a platform for connecting to a central server that manages and tracks operations in real-time for employees, inventories, and equipment. The construction industry currently employs a wide variety of devices for a variety of tasks.

By using sensors, drones, CCTV cameras, and radio-frequency Identification (RFID) tags, IoT-based solutions link construction sites. This enables the collection of real-time data statistics about the workers, inventories, and ongoing activities. Among other advantages, sensors and RFID tags on materials allow for efficient workflows, proactive material ordering, equipment servicing, monitoring of equipment usage, and preventative maintenance. On construction sites, efficient time management minimizes downtime for personnel and equipment, which saves time and money from delays.

Furthermore, most third-party businesses involved in business operations maintain the information technology systems and networks. Data processing and maintenance involving connected IoT devices is vulnerable to coordinated and targeted cyberattacks. The integrity and confidentiality of the data are compromised as a result. Such cyberattacks may harm consumers' reputations, which may result in fines, legal action from the government, litigation with third parties, and other consequences in addition to informational harm. Such flaws pose a serious risk to IoT implementation, particularly in the construction sector. Thus, rise in security threats in connected devices restrain the growth of IoT in construction market.

Moreover, the construction industry is one of the largest consumers of natural resources. The bulk consumption of resources results in production of huge amounts of construction & demolition (C&D) waste. Construction industry contributes highly toward global carbon emission owing to the use of cement and other construction materials. The existing waste management approaches mainly aim at managing the waste after it is generated. However, with the use of IoT based software, and building information modelling, proper resource planning can be conducted which further reduces the generation of wastage. Data driven decision making during the planning and designing stage of construction project can prevent the aftermath of waste generation and disposal to a large extent. Thus, the use of IoT technologies can help in resource and waste optimization, which in turn is expected to drive the growth and offer IoT in construction market opportunities.
